This is sort of a kicking tires type of question - problem doesn't happen every time but enough to be annoying -

Everything in the flight(s) works as expected except the volume of the comms might get so low it is difficult to hear and then the response is loud and normal. Might happen once or twice during a flight or not at all.

I have the output routed to a headset using W10's built in audio router.

Anyone run into this before?

PF3 has a feature that simulates poor reception occasionally, to increase realism. You can adjust the probability of poor-quality transmissions or disable the feature entirely. Options #2, Advanced Options and INI File Tweaks, COMs section, Poor Reception. See also the User Guide, p. 71.
